在当今这个移动应用盛行的时代,掌握Android应用开发技能显得尤为重要。而UniAPP作为一个跨平台框架,可以帮助开发者更高效地开发出适用于多平台的应用。本文将详细介绍如何在Android平台上安装与配置UniAPP插件,让你轻松上手。
一、UniAPP简介
UniAPP是一个使用Vue.js开发所有前端应用的框架,可以编译到iOS、Android、H5、以及各种小程序等多个平台。它通过一套代码实现多端运行,大大提高了开发效率。
二、安装UniAPP插件
1. 创建Android项目
首先,你需要创建一个Android项目。这里以Android Studio为例,打开Android Studio,点击“Start a new Android Studio project”,选择“Empty Activity”模板,然后点击“Next”。
2. 添加UniAPP插件
在创建项目的过程中,选择“Add Activity”选项,然后选择“Empty Activity”。接下来,在“Configure your new application”页面中,勾选“Include dependencies for third-party libraries”,然后点击“Finish”。
3. 下载UniAPP插件
在Android Studio中,打开“Project Structure”窗口,选择“SDK Location”,点击“+”,然后选择“UniAPP Plugin”。在弹出的窗口中,选择合适的插件版本,点击“Download”按钮。
4. 配置UniAPP插件
下载完成后,回到“Project Structure”窗口,选择“UniAPP Plugin”,然后点击“OK”按钮。这时,Android Studio会自动配置UniAPP插件。
三、配置UniAPP插件
1. 修改AndroidManifest.xml
在Android项目的根目录下,找到AndroidManifest.xml文件,并添加以下代码:
<application
android:name="io.dcloud.application.DCloudApplication"
android:allowBackup="true"
android:icon="@mipmap/ic_launcher"
android:label="@string/app_name"
android:roundIcon="@mipmap/ic_launcher_round"
android:supportsRtl="true"
android:theme="@style/Theme.AppCompat.Light.NoActionBar">
<activity
android:name="io.dcloud.ui.DHActivity"
android:configChanges="orientation|keyboardHidden|screenSize"
android:hardwareAccelerated="true"
android:launchMode="singleTask"
android:screenOrientation="sensor"
android:theme="@style/Theme.AppCompat.Light.NoActionBar">
<intent-filter>
<action android:name="android.intent.action.MAIN" />
<category android:name="android.intent.category.LAUNCHER" />
</intent-filter>
</activity>
</application>
2. 修改build.gradle
在项目的build.gradle文件中,添加以下代码:
dependencies {
implementation 'io.dcloud:uniapp-plugin:1.0.0'
}
3. 修改app/src/main/java/包名/MainActivity.java
在MainActivity.java文件中,修改以下代码:
package 包名;
import io.dcloud.ui.DHActivity;
public class MainActivity extends DHActivity {
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
}
}
四、总结
通过以上步骤,你已经在Android平台上成功安装与配置了UniAPP插件。接下来,你可以使用UniAPP框架开发跨平台应用了。希望本文能对你有所帮助,祝你学习愉快!
